Early Life & Foundation

Dana didn’t start in a plush office chair. Born and bred in Massachusetts before moving to California, he was the guy hustling boxing gyms and managing fighters in the ’90s. Nobody predicted he’d one day control the biggest MMA empire on earth.

How UFC Found Its Kingpin

In 2001, White, alongside the Fertitta brothers, snapped up the UFC for under $3 million. Fast forward, Dana’s driven UFC into a multi-billion-dollar enterprise. More than just a boss, he’s the brand’s relentless face.

Career Growth & Breakthrough Era

The 2000s were a wild ride. UFC started as a niche spectacle, almost dead, until Dana switched gears, introducing reality TV like The Ultimate Fighter, boosting fame off octagon hype.

Pay-Per-View Power

The real cash flow exploded with pay-per-view events. Dana’s shrewd negotiations and muscle helped secure staggering media deals that fattened his and UFC’s bank accounts.

Peak Earnings Era

By the 2010s, he wasn’t just an executive; he was a mogul. Sale of UFC to WME-IMG in 2016 for over $4 billion secured Dana a large stake worth hundreds of millions instantly.

Streaming Era & Modern Income

The streaming age redefined content delivery. UFC embraced digital platforms, increasing reach and revenue streams, including exclusive contracts with ESPN, expanding Dana’s annual income even in a chaotic media environment.
